- Title:
- Private Letter (SB XX 14449, P.Lond. III 1078 descr., TM 39683)
- Scope & Content:
- Private letter requesting permission for a visit, mentioning letters from Babylon and the dispatch of a pair of beast’s loads. With address on the back.

- Extent:
- Papyrus sheet, paler by patches, complete but with holes throughout; written on both sides. The front bears 10 lines written along the fibres, complete; margins survive. On the back there is one damaged line written along the fibres. The papyrus is housed in a glass frame.
